Dr. Yasser Al-Khatib, MD is a pediatric cardiologist in Grand Rapids, MI and has over 40 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Aleppo School of Medicine in 1982.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Corewell Health Butterworth Hospital and Corewell Health Lakeland St Joseph Hospital. He is accepting new patients.
